Embodiment 1

[0046] A preparation method of a composite photocatalyst with high efficiency near-infrared photoresponse, comprising the following steps:

[0047] First, NaGdF was synthesized by co-precipitation method 4 :49%Yb / 1%Tm, that is, the molar ratio of Gd:Yb:Tm=0.5:0.49:0.01, 1mL gadolinium acetate aqueous solution (0.2M, i.e. 0.2mol / L), 0.98mL ytterbium acetate aqueous solution (0.2M, That is, 0.2mol / L) and 0.2mL thulium acetate aqueous solution (0.02M, ie 0.2mol / L) were added to a 50mL two-necked flask containing 4mL oleic acid, and the above mixed solution was stirred and heated in an oil bath, and the temperature was raised to 150°C. Abstract

The invention discloses an efficient near-infrared light responsive compound photocatalyst, a preparation method and an application thereof in photocatalytic degradation of organic pollutants in water. The preparation method comprises the following steps: utilizing a hydrothermal method to compound an up-conversion material NaGdF4:49%Yb / 1%Tm@NaGdF4, and then combining the up-conversion material with the photocatalyst, thereby generating a novel compound photocatalyst NaGdF4: Yb / Tm@NaGdF4@TiO2. Under near-infrared light, the photocatalyst is capable of quickly degrading wastewater containing dyestuff rhodamine B. The technology is capable of efficiently utilizing solar energy, is capable of effectively degrading organic pollutants in waste, is safe and nontoxic and is free from secondary pollution to environment.

technical field [0001] The invention relates to the field of environmental functional materials, in particular to a composite photocatalyst with high-efficiency near-infrared light response, a preparation method thereof, and an application in photocatalytic degradation of organic pollutants in water bodies. Background technique [0002] Since the last century, with the rapid development of various industries, especially petrochemical, printing and dyeing industries, various wastewater containing organic pollutants has entered the water body, causing serious environmental pollution and threatening the health of various organisms. These pollutants last for a long time, are not completely decomposed, and the intermediate products are highly toxic and complex in composition.
